Sources: Pelicans acquire Poole in 4-player deal

The Pelicans are trading CJ McCollum, Kelly Olynyk and a future second-round pick to the Wizards for Jordan Poole, Saddiq Bey and the No. 40 pick in this year’s NBA draft, sources tell ESPN’s Shams Charania.
